What this is
CHAOSS Record Release Tour 'FxxKING CHAPTER' is a live music event celebrating both the band's new record release and the birthday of CHAOSS member Rai, themed 'Ash and Light.' The show takes place at BlackHole in Tokyo, a venue associated with the Japanese underground rock and visual-kei adjacent live music scene. Birthday live events are a beloved tradition in Japanese music culture, where fan communities gather to celebrate an artist's birthday with special performances, unique setlists, and often exclusive merchandise. This event combines the energy of a tour stop with the intimacy and celebratory atmosphere of a birthday live, making it a distinctive night for dedicated fans.

Good to know
Tickets for this event are most likely available via eplus.jp or through CHAOSS's official fan channels — foreign credit cards are generally accepted on eplus, and convenience store pickup at Lawson is the most reliable collection method for visitors without a Japanese delivery address. BlackHole is a small live house venue in Tokyo suited to intimate underground performances, so expect a standing floor with limited capacity and a close-up view of the stage. Merchandise for birthday lives is typically sold before doors open and quantities are strictly limited, so plan to queue early. Cash is strongly recommended for drinks and any on-the-night purchases. Show duration for live house events of this type is typically 90 minutes to two hours including any encore.
